Transaction 2b33c608f5d113be180269350f320862348faed06a044f5b1e4cf1ec36964118

1 Input
2 Outputs
  • 2b33c608f5d113be180269350f320862348faed06a044f5b1e4cf1ec36964118:0
  • value  44731127
    address  3PDAhFVzeTG4zw8FMsAcMLanxy4BGxHE19
  • 2b33c608f5d113be180269350f320862348faed06a044f5b1e4cf1ec36964118:1
  • value  2500000
    address  1H7D8eJrYRYWivyuTfUhsvcLTN4pcirQvk